Output 391e657dd7d9c352ded9c658ec3b6948dc3c0f39aa8b7607280c8f7bbbb95f65:2

value
6548927
script pubkey
OP_0 OP_PUSHBYTES_20 50c599249611dff3aeffc83dfc158a18368a146c
address
ltc1q2rzejfykz80l8thleq7lc9v2rqmg59rv2uprtk
transaction
391e657dd7d9c352ded9c658ec3b6948dc3c0f39aa8b7607280c8f7bbbb95f65
spent
true